Dorothy M. Stafford

March 29, 1927 — June 17, 2019

Dorothy “Dottie” M. Wills Stafford, age 92, of Iron River, MI, passed away on Monday, June 17, 2019 at Aspirus Wausau Hospital after complications during an angiogram. She was born on March 29, 1927 in Galena, IL, the daughter of the late Maurice and Marcella (Klaas) Wills. She was raised on a dairy farm in Hazel Green, WI, with five siblings.  She attended Hazel Green High School, graduating with the Class of 1945. Dottie married Robert “Bob” Stafford on May 4, 1946 in Hazel Green, WI, and the couple just celebrated their 73rd wedding anniversary. She was a great cook, working at Balducci’s Super Club, Alice’s, & Dina Mia Kitchens until the age of 80.  She also worked as a Parent Coordinator for Follow-Through Program & a teacher’s Aide at Central School.  She was such a hard working person. She peeled pulp in the woods, when her husband was a logger, worked 12 years at Coleman Products on the assembly line, and cleaned the St John’s Episcopal Church for the past 20 years, up until her death. She graduated from Nicolet Technical College in Rhinelander in Culinary Arts. She was very active in her community, a longtime member/Officer of the American Legion Post 17 Auxiliary, and President of the VFW Post 3134 Auxiliary. She was a member of St. Agnes Catholic Church of Iron River and the Altar Society and the St Agnes Crafters. She was on several bowling leagues and joined the cribbage group at the Senior Center. She had a youthful spirit and loved spending time and traveling with her family & friends, visiting Europe, Ireland, Canada, and all over the United States. She was a stylish dresser even as she aged. She was always willing to help out, even at the age of 92. She always made others feel welcomed and loved. She loved to dance, and enjoyed telling jokes and always the life of the party. She was a kind hearted beautiful lady, a devoted, loving mother and grandmother and will be deeply missed.
